Super Sunday is gearing up to reopen rivalries that have fascinated cricket fans for years.

The second match of the double-header in Colombo will see arch rivals India and Pakistan taking on each other in what is anticipated to be the biggest clash in the Super Eights.

Pakistan would almost confirm their path into the semi-finals with a win while India are eager to break their Super Eights jinx.

Pakistan would consider themselves lucky to have won their first match in the Super Eights.

After a wholehearted performance by the bowlers, the batsmen had all but ruined the efforts before it took an unlikely batting hero in Umar Gul to steer them to win.

Umar Akmal ably supported him as Pakistan won by two wickets. Captain Mohammad Hafeez was upbeat about the team’s chances given the fighting spirit the team has shown.

An India-Pakistan match always has an air of unpredictability around it and that would mean that Shahid Afridi and Shoaib Malik retain their places despite indifferent performances.

India, on the other hand, are fighting to stay alive in the tournament after the mauling they got at the hands of Australia.

The task is not easy for captain MS Dhoni has had to battle criticism over his decision to drop Virender Sehwag.

The pundits have raised concerns over Yuvraj Singh’s selection and Sunday could see the below-par fitness batsman being dropped in favor of Sehwag who has a hugely successful record against Pakistan.

Virat Kohli will be expected to shoulder the batting duties and also did well in the warm-up against Pakistan, a match that India eventually lost.

Come Sunday, at least one record would have to go. It will either be Pakistan’s first win over India in a major ICC tournament or it will be India’s first win in a World T20 Super Eights match since 2007.
